Product reviews:
Maximilian
2025-12-11 iphone SE
Hot Wheels Monster Trucks Live UK hot wheels monster trucks live schedule
hot wheels monster trucks live schedule
Hot Wheels is bringing a live Monsters hot wheels monster trucks live schedule
hot wheels monster trucks live schedule
Roy
2025-12-08 iphone XS Max
chance to win tickets to Hot Wheels hot wheels monster trucks live schedule
hot wheels monster trucks live schedule